Overworked, Under-Resourced, and Overwhelmed: The Reality for Nonprofit Salesforce Admins

Running Salesforce for a nonprofit isn't just about clicking buttons—it’s about wearing 10 different hats while trying to keep the system running. Many nonprofit staffers find themselves as ‘accidental admins’—handling data, integrations, and reports on top of their already full plates. Sound familiar?


Common Challenges Faced by Nonprofit Salesforce Admins

Nonprofit admins are expected to keep everything running smoothly, but without the same resources that for-profit companies allocate to their CRM teams. This leads to:


Data Management Issues – Duplicate records, incomplete donor information, and inconsistent reporting structures.

Reporting Bottlenecks – Fundraising and leadership teams struggle to get real-time, accurate insights due to complex or outdated reports.

Integration Challenges – Critical systems such as email marketing, event registration, donation platforms, and accounting software often do not sync properly, leading to manual data entry and inefficiencies.

Limited Time for Strategic Optimization – Admins are stuck in reactive mode, fixing immediate problems instead of implementing long-term solutions.

Lack of Ongoing Support and Training – System updates, security concerns, and automation improvements often get deprioritized, leading to technical debt and inefficiencies.


The Solution: Moving from Survival Mode to Strategic Success

Rather than relying on a single, overburdened admin to handle Salesforce, nonprofits need a structured, scalable approach to CRM management. This includes:


Dedicated Admin Support – A part-time Salesforce consultant can help clean up data, optimize processes, and provide technical guidance without the cost of a full-time hire.

Smart Automation – Workflows, donor engagement tracking, and campaign management should be automated to reduce manual effort and human error.

Seamless Integrations – Email platforms, event management systems, fundraising tools, and financial software should connect properly with Salesforce to ensure a single source of truth..

Ongoing System Optimization – Salesforce should be regularly maintained, updated, and improved to prevent data silos and system breakdowns.
